What Matters Most When she found out her mother was dying of ovarian cancer, Mary Marcdante (a contributor to Chicken Soup for the Mother's Soul) realized that she had precious little time to get to know her as more than ""just my mother."" Recognizing that mother-daughter relationships are often mired in conflicting emotions, Marcdante decided to write My Mother, My Friend: The Ten Most Important Things to Talk About with Your Mother for adult daughters hoping to share a new level of friendship with their moms. She offers clear, practical advice on how to broach weighty subjects (such as aging, death, financial security) and how to listen actively, along with ideas for spending time together. ( Apr. 2)
